Output 36ae2f24107691686ff416a4392155b7a7bacdc5cb9ac98f92c5075f31f3fb6e:1

value
3023783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6805debf5db1f019795c7284a5d130db2df61598 OP_EQUAL
address
3BB3EMcySDhixuYy6YifRSc8B8yTadQSTb
transaction
36ae2f24107691686ff416a4392155b7a7bacdc5cb9ac98f92c5075f31f3fb6e
confirmations
128660
spent
true